PHP file_exists() Function

Definition and Usage
The file_exists() function checks whether or not a file or directory exists.
This function returns TRUE if the file or directory exists, otherwise it returns FALSE.
Syntax
file_exists(path)
Parameter | Description |
---|---|
path | Required. Specifies the path to check |
Example
<?php
echo file_exists("test.txt");
?>
The output of the code above will be:
1
